📜  HTML | DOM Video videoTracks 属性

📅  最后修改于: 2021-11-07 07:49:26             🧑  作者: Mango

Video videoTracks 属性用于返回VideoTrackList 对象。 VideoTrackList 对象通常用于表示视频可用的可用视频轨道。
每个可用的视频轨道由一个单独的 VideoTrack 对象表示。

句法:

videoObject.videoTracks

返回值:

  1. VideoTrackList 对象:它表示视频的可用视频轨道。
    • videoTracks.length:用于获取视频中可用的文本轨道数。
    • videoTracks[index]:用于通过索引获取VideoTrack对象。
    • VideoTrackList 对象:用于表示视频可用的视频轨道。
    • videoTracks.getTrackById(id):用于通过id获取VideoTrack对象。
  2. VideoTrack 对象:它代表一个视频轨道。
    • kind:用于获取视频轨道的类型。
    • label:用于获取视频轨道的标签。
    • 语言:用于获取视频文本轨道的语言。
    • id:用于获取视频轨道的id。
    • selected:用于获取或设置轨道是否处于活动状态。

下面的程序说明了 Video videoTracks 属性:

示例:获取可用视频轨道的数量。

HTML


 

    
        DOM Video videoTracks Property
    

 

 
    

      GeeksforGeeks   

    

      Video videoTracks Property   

    
              

To get the number of available video tracks of       the video, double click the "Return Video Tracks" button.         
                     

                


输出:

  • 点击按钮前:

  • 点击按钮后:

支持的浏览器: HTML不支持主流浏览器 | DOM 视频 videoTracks 属性

  • 谷歌浏览器
  • IE浏览器
  • 火狐
  • 歌剧
  • 苹果Safari